A musty smell in the basement or crawl space is usually moisture you can't see yet, not just "old house smell."
Stair-step cracks in block foundations are a common early warning sign we see across Kentucky, KY-area homes.
It's easy to dismiss efflorescence as harmless dust, but it actually signals active moisture movement through the wall.
If your pump is running around the clock instead of only during storms, it's worth having it evaluated before it fails completely.
If a foundation wall looks like it's leaning or bulging inward, that's beyond a simple seal and needs a full assessment.
